Hi Everyone,
Went to put some grease into the zerks on my Jinma FEL and found the grease squeezed out around the nipple, none going inside. Bought a new grease gun end fitting - still no improvement, same problem.
Took grease fitting out and tried to identify the thread type and size. This is where it gets strange. The grease fitting has a metric thread of sorts but is very fine. I have both metric and imperial grease fittings (spares) and the Jinma one does not match any of them. Has anyone been able to identify the fitting size and thread?
Reason I ask is that I really don't want to drill and tap to install better zerks, however, I guess I am going to have to if there are not any worthwhile replacements. The zerks that came with the FEL have the nipple a smaller size than would be the normal standard (imperial or metric) and I haven't yet found a fitting coupler that will work with them.
By the way, the zerks on the Jinma 554 tractor are fine and I have been able to grease these without any problems.
Maybe this is just another anomoly with the chinses tracor that needs to be sorted out.
